Our invention relates to certain new and useful improvements in clutches; and its object is to provide a device of this class which shall be cheaperand more elfective than those hitherto in use.
To these and certain minor ends our invention consists in certain novel features of construction, which are fully illustrated in the accompanying drawings and described in this specification.
In the drawings, Figure lis a side elevation of our improved clutch, a certain portion of the pulley being broken away to show the interior construction. Fig. 2 is a diametrical section in the line 2 2 of Fig. 1. Fig. 3 is a section inthe line 3 3 of Fig. 2. spective of the spiral band, which is the connecting element of the clutch; and Fig. 5 is a diametrical section illustrating the clutch upon a line-shaft and adapted to connect the two adjacent ends of two sections of the same.
Referring to the drawings, A is a shaft on which the pulley is mounted.
B is an enlarged cylindrical portion or boss, which closely ts the shaft and is secured against rotation by a key Z).
C is the pulley, which runs loose on the shaft and is constructed as shown in Fig. 2, Wherein C is a suitable web forming one end face of the pulley, and C2 is the peripheral portion thereof. The opposite end'of the pulley C is formed by a web D, integral witha sleeve D', which also runs loose upon the shaft. The web D is rigidly secured t'o the peripheral portion C2 ofthe pulley C. Upon the'sleeve D is a longitudinally-movable collar E, secured against rotation on the sleeve by a key e. This collar can be shifted longitudinally by a suitable fork of the usual type, (designated by the letter F.)
Inside the hollow pulley C is a spiral strap Fig. 4t is a per-- G, surrounding the boss B. A suitable hook g engages a projecting lug c upon the web C of the pulley and is held in place by a similar lug c'. The opposite end of the strap terminates in an upward bend or shoulder g'. (Shown in Fig. 3.) Against this shoulder rests the head of a screw 71 adjustably secured in the end of a lever II, which is pivoted between its ends on a suitable bracket d, secured to the web D. This lever has a beveled surface 71', which is engaged by a suitable roller e' upon the periphery of the collar E. It will be seen that when the collar E is forced toward the pulley C the roller e' bears upon the beveled surface h of the lever, thereby swinging the lever and correspondingly moving the shoulder` g' of the strap G through the contact of the screw 71, therewith. This tightens the strap upon the boss B and causes the pulley C, sleeve D, and collar E to rotate with the shaft and boss. Whcnthe fork F is shifted back to the position shown in Fig. l, the elasticity of the strap, which is preferably constructed of spring-steel, loosens it upon the boss and releases the pulley from its connection therewith. This 'isin brief, the operation of the clutch.
The advantage of this clutch lies in the fact that the cl utching-surface is elastic and adapts itself to any irregularities of the surface of the boss. In clutches of ordinary types itis almost impossible to get an absolutely true surface, and as a result onlya few points are in actual engagement at any one time, an unsatisfactory result beingthereby produced. With our clutch, however, the strap tightens up and accommodates itself to any irregularities which may exist, either originally or in consequence of wear upon the boss, and a tight grasp is at all. times assured.
This clutch can be equally well applied to -line-shafts, .and this modification is illustrated in Fig. 5, wherein the construction is precisely the same, except that two shafts A and A2 are shown supported in any suitable journals. The shaft Ais a driving-shaft, and it has keyed to it the boss B, as has the driving-shaft in the preferred form. A2 is the driven shaft, and to it is keyed the pul.-
